One user account can't connect to VPN on Server 2012

$
0
0

Problem with Server 2012 VPN Access.  I have one user account that won't connect to RAS and I am stumped.  No other account is having a problem.  The permissions are correct, the connection settings are correct.  But it will not connect no matter what I do.  The account will not connect from any computer.  But if I use another account in the connection it connects no problem.   The account will connect to Remote Web Workplace no problem, Outlook is connecting to exchange, she connects to Sharepoint 2013 no problem.  Just the RAS connection won't authenticate.

I get the errors.

Error 20271 CoId={79DB7056-D8F6-489E-8988-66A171AE49B9}: The user  connected from IP but failed an authentication attempt due to the following reason: The connection was prevented because of a policy configured on your RAS/VPN server. Specifically, the authentication method used by the server to verify your username and password may not match the authentication method configured in your connection profile. Please contact the Administrator of the RAS server and notify them of this error.

Error 20258 CoId={79DB7056-D8F6-489E-8988-66A171AE49B9}: The account for user  connected on port VPN1-127 does not have Remote Access privilege.  The line has been disconnected.

And this account was connecting fine for a while now.  Nothing has changed on the Server or her computer.

I have researched the errors, none of the fixes apply because it's only one account having problems and it looks exactly the same as other accounts that can connect

Any help would be great
